The Industrial Exhaust Fan

Bearing in mind the level of heat and energy generated inside an industry, it appears suicidal when you think of the absence of fans in such an environment. In fact, the stringent measures put in place to ensure that air circulation in given industries is kept steady, demand that certain capacities of industrial exhaust fan are installed for the required service. Whenever companies are out sourcing for such equipment, they usually look for those which require low maintenance and the ones which are also low priced.

There are different types of industrial exhaust fans but their similarity is brought about by the fact that they are all made from heavy grade metals that are meant to be long lasting. The commonly used types are steel alloys, as they are quite strong and long lasting.

An industrial exhaust fan is made from a metal gauge which is much smaller as compared to the one used in normal fans. In other words, the metals used in the construction of these fans are thicker and larger. Other than just air conditioning industries, industrial exhaust fans are also used to suck out any form of bad vapors or fumes which might be emanating from the industries. The ones which are part of an air conditioning system inside the industry are fixed in place, but there are others which are mobile and they usually have a metal cage covering them to avoid injuries and damage.

An electric motor is the one which is responsible for running an industrial exhaust fan once connected to a power source. Metal shafts attached to the motor are rotated using electromagnetic waves and the end result is huge metal blades spinning at a bended angle slicing air and forcing it into a vent. The flow of electricity to the motor is regulated by a capacitor, and this is what determines the speed at which the industrial exhaust fan rotates.

When an industrial exhaust fan is used for collection of air and bad fumes from an industry, it mostly forces the particles out of the establishment through tubes that ensure the foul air is let out into the environment. In such a case, the industrial exhaust fan usually faces upwards so that air is sliced towards the outside as opposed to its being sliced towards the inside. The volume of foul air that can be evacuated from an industry by an industrial exhaust fan depends on the speed at which it is revolving.

When seeking to purchase industrial exhaust fans, most companies are hell bent on ensuring that they get the best in terms of service. This is usually determined by the size of the industry and the function of the fan. The goings on inside the industry are also determinants of the type and size of fan that is supposed to be purchased. It is important to note that industrial exhaust fan are used to remove heat from the upper part of a room as well, other than just toxic fumes.
